Comprehending Car Key Technology
To value the requirement of programming, one need to comprehend how contemporary keys connect with the lorry. Many cars and trucks made after the mid-1990s make use of an immobilizer system. This system includes a transponder chip embedded in the key head and an antenna ring around the ignition cylinder (or a sensor inside the control panel for push-to-start lorries).
When the key is placed or brought into proximity, the Engine Control Unit (ECU) sends a signal to the key. The key must react with a special, pre-programmed code. If the code matches, the immobilizer is deactivated, and the engine starts. Without this digital "handshake," the car remains stationary, regardless of whether the physical key fits the lock.

Emergency car key programming normally ends up being essential when the synchronization in between the automobile and the key is severed. This can occur all of a sudden, leaving a motorist stranded in a car park or at home.
Total Key Loss: The most regular emergency situation takes place when the owner loses all functioning secrets. In this case, a locksmith professional must not only cut a new blade but also gain access to the car's computer to "introduce" a brand-new set of digital credentials.Transponder Damage: Dropping a key on concrete or exposing it to water can damage the internal RFID chip. Even if the mechanical part of the key turns the ignition, the Car Key Remote Programming will not start.Battery Depletion and Desynchronization: In some automobiles, permitting a key fob battery to stay dead for an extended period can cause it to lose its coupling with the lorry's receiver.Theft or Security Resets: If a vehicle is burglarized or an attempt is made to bypass the ignition, the security system may enter a "lockout mode" that requires a professional reset and reprogramming.The Process of Emergency Car Key Programming
When an expert mobile locksmith or professional gets here at the scene, the process follows a specific technical protocol. Unlike a car dealership which may need the automobile to be hauled to their service center, emergency mobile services perform these actions on-site.
Step 1: Identification and Decoding
The specialist initially recognizes the car's particular make, model, and year. They use the Vehicle Identification Number (VIN) to pull the key code and pin code (security code) from a protected database.
Action 2: Gaining Entry and Cutting the Blade
If the secrets are lost, the technician must acquire entry to the vehicle using specialized tools that do not harm the lock. They then utilize a CNC laser cutter to create a mechanical key that fits the ignition or door locks.
Action 3: OBD-II Connection
The core of the programming takes place through the On-Board Diagnostics (OBD-II) port. The specialist links an advanced programming tablet to the automobile's computer system.
Step 4: Coding and Synchronization
Using specialized software, the specialist clears any old key data (to ensure lost secrets can no longer begin the Car Key Programmer) and goes into the new chip ID into the ECU. For many modern-day cars, this requires a live connection to the maker's server to confirm the security credentials.
Step 5: Final Testing
The specialist makes sure the car starts, the remote buttons lock/unlock the doors, and any auxiliary functions (like trunk release or panic alarms) are totally operational.

In the age of YouTube tutorials, numerous motorists are lured to buy cheap key blanks online and effort to configure them using "onboard" series (e.g., turning the ignition five times and pressing the brake).
While some older domestic cars permit DIY programming if you already have two working keys, a lot of modern-day vehicles need specific devices.

Can a car be programmed if the battery is dead?
No. The car's computer system requires a steady power source to interact with the programming tool. If the car battery is dead, the specialist will usually jump-start it or connect a power maintainer before starting the programming procedure.
2. How long does emergency situation car key programming take?
Usually, the physical programming takes between 15 to 30 minutes. Nevertheless, the entire procedure, including cutting the key and getting entry to the vehicle, can take 45 to 90 minutes depending upon the complexity of the vehicle's security system.
3. Does insurance coverage cover the expense of emergency key programming?
Many extensive insurance coverage or "Roadside Assistance" add-ons cover locksmith professional services. Nevertheless, they might have a cap (e.g., as much as ₤ 100). It is best to check your policy information.
4. Can every car be configured at the roadside?
The majority of cars and trucks can be. Nevertheless, some high-security European brand names (like particular BMW, Mercedes, or Volvo models) have "rolling code" systems that are exceptionally limiting. In uncommon cases, these keys must be purchased straight from the factory in Germany utilizing the VIN.
5. Why is programming so costly compared to a home key?
A home key is a mechanical copy. A car key is a specialized computer system part. The cost shows the expense of the transponder innovation, the pricey software licensing needed to access the vehicle's ECU, and the specialized training of the technician.
